Foreign4 months ago
France’s Political Shockwave: Left Triumphs, Far-Right Falls
(iexclusivenews) – In a stunning turn of events, France’s political arena has been dramatically reshaped following the second-round parliamentary elections. This comprehensive analysis delves into the...